在数字化时代,个人信息的安全问题日益凸显。越权访问,即未经授权的用户或系统获取并使用敏感信息,是信息安全领域的一大风险。为了守护我们的隐私防线,选择合适的安全防护软件至关重要。本文将深入探讨越权访问的风险,并介绍如何利用安全防护软件来防范此类风险。
越权访问的风险分析
1. 数据泄露
越权访问可能导致敏感数据泄露,如个人身份信息、财务信息、商业机密等。一旦泄露,可能造成严重的后果,包括经济损失、声誉损害等。
2. 系统瘫痪
越权访问可能导致系统功能异常,甚至瘫痪,影响正常业务运营。
3. 恶意攻击
越权访问可能被恶意利用,成为攻击者入侵系统的入口,进一步破坏系统安全。
安全防护软件的作用
1. 访问控制
安全防护软件可以通过设置访问权限,确保只有授权用户才能访问特定资源。例如,使用角色基础访问控制(RBAC)技术,根据用户角色分配访问权限。
2. 数据加密
对敏感数据进行加密,即使数据被非法获取,也无法解读其内容。常用的加密算法包括AES、RSA等。
3. 安全审计
安全防护软件可以记录用户操作日志,便于追踪和审计。一旦发现异常行为,可以及时采取措施。
4. 防火墙和入侵检测
防火墙可以阻止未授权的访问请求,入侵检测系统可以实时监测网络流量,发现潜在威胁。
如何选择安全防护软件
1. 功能需求
根据实际需求,选择具备相应功能的安全防护软件。例如,需要保护云数据,可以选择云安全解决方案。
2. 性能要求
选择性能稳定、响应速度快的软件,确保系统正常运行。
3. 用户体验
软件界面友好,易于操作,降低用户使用门槛。
4. 品牌信誉
选择知名品牌的安全防护软件,确保产品质量和售后服务。
实例分析
以下是一个使用安全防护软件防范越权访问的实例:
# 假设使用某安全防护软件实现访问控制
# 定义用户角色和权限
user_roles = {
'admin': ['read', 'write', 'delete'],
'editor': ['read', 'write'],
'viewer': ['read']
}
# 定义资源
resources = {
'data1': ['admin', 'editor'],
'data2': ['admin', 'editor', 'viewer']
}
# 检查用户权限
def check_permission(user, resource):
if user in user_roles and resource in resources:
permissions = user_roles[user]
if 'read' in permissions:
print(f"{user} has read permission for {resource}")
if 'write' in permissions:
print(f"{user} has write permission for {resource}")
if 'delete' in permissions:
print(f"{user} has delete permission for {resource}")
else:
print(f"{user} does not have permission for {resource}")
# 测试
check_permission('admin', 'data1') # 输出:admin has read, write, delete permission for data1
check_permission('editor', 'data2') # 输出:editor has read, write permission for data2
check_permission('viewer', 'data2') # 输出:viewer does not have permission for data2
通过以上实例,我们可以看到安全防护软件在防范越权访问方面的作用。
总结
越权访问是信息安全领域的一大风险,选择合适的安全防护软件可以有效守护隐私防线。在数字化时代,我们要时刻关注信息安全,提高自我保护意识,共同维护网络环境的安全与稳定。
